Performance
The chipset is where the most significant difference lies. The Oppo Reno9 utilizes the Qualcomm Snapdragon 778G 5G (6nm), a capable mid-range processor. However, the Samsung Galaxy S23 FE is equipped with either the Exynos 2200 (International) or the Snapdragon 8 Gen 1 (USA), both built on a more efficient 4nm process. The Exynos 2200’s Cortex-X2 prime core, clocked at 2.8 GHz, and the Snapdragon 8 Gen 1’s 3.0 GHz core, offer substantially higher peak performance than the Reno9’s Cortex-A78. This translates to faster app loading times, smoother multitasking, and a better gaming experience. The 4nm process also contributes to improved thermal efficiency, potentially mitigating throttling during sustained workloads. The Reno9’s CPU configuration, while octa-core, relies on older Cortex-A78 cores, limiting its overall performance ceiling.
Battery Life
The Samsung Galaxy S23 FE achieves an impressive 8:28h of active use, demonstrating strong battery optimization despite its powerful processor. The Oppo Reno9’s battery capacity is not specified, but its 67W wired charging is a standout feature, capable of charging from 0 to 33% in just 10 minutes and reaching 100% in 44 minutes. The S23 FE’s 25W charging is considerably slower, taking 30 minutes to reach 50%. While the S23 FE’s battery life is excellent, the Reno9’s charging speed offers unparalleled convenience for users who frequently need to top up their device. The S23 FE also supports 15W wireless and reverse wireless charging, features absent on the Reno9.
